Warning Signs You Need Cabinet Water Damage Repair

Don’t ignore these warning signs of Cabinet Water Damage Repair. Catching issues early can save you money and prevent bigger problems down the line. Musty Odors Water Stains and Warped Cabinets are all signs that you need professional help.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

When you notice a persistent musty smell in your cabinets, it’s time to act. This can be a sign of hidden water damage or high humidity in the area. Don’t Ignore the Smell Investigate the Cause and Call a Pro for help.

Water Stains on Cabinets

Water stains on your cabinets can be a sign of a larger issue. If you notice any discoloration or staining, it’s essential to investigate further. Check for Water Damage Assess the Situation and Call a Pro for help.

Warped Cabinets

Warped or bowed cabinets can be a sign of structural compromise. This can lead to further damage and even safety hazards. Inspect Your Cabinets Look for Signs of Damage and Call a Pro to ensure your cabinets are safe and functional.

Cabinet Water Damage Repair v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water stain on a single cabinet Yes No DIY is fine for small, isolated issues.
Visible water damage on multiple cabinets No Yes Call a pro for more extensive damage to ensure safety and prevent further issues.
Musty odors in multiple rooms No Yes Hidden water damage or high humidity may be the cause, and a pro can help you identify and fix the issue.
Warped or bowed cabinets No Yes Structural compromise may be the cause, and a pro can help you assess and repair the damage.
Water damage on a large surface area No Yes Call a pro for more extensive damage to ensure safety and prevent further issues.
Hidden water damage or high humidity No Yes A pro can help you identify and fix the issue before it becomes a bigger problem.

Cabinet Water Damage Repair Cost In River Ridge, LA

The cost of Cabinet Water Damage Repair can vary dep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in River Ridge, LA. These estimates are based on real-world costs and should be used as a guide only. Get a Free Estimate Understand the Costs and Make an Informed Decision.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Cabinet disassembly and repair $1,000 – $5,000 Severity of damage, type of repair needed
Final inspection and completion $200 – $1,000 Complexity of repair, more work needed
Emergency response and assessment $100 – $500 Time of day, distance to your property
Hidden water damage detection $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
High-humidity control and prevention $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
